Description

The WF43VSZAEDNT0 is a 4.3-inch TFT LCD module designed for industrial applications, offering high brightness of 550 cd/m² and a resolution of 480x272 pixels. This module incorporates O-Film technology, providing wide viewing angles and an anti-glare surface, making it ideal for use in environments where visibility is crucial. It is equipped with a Resistive Touch Panel (RTP) for user interaction.

Built-in with the ST7282-G4-1L driver IC, the WF43VSZAEDNT0 supports 24-bit RGB interfaces, ensuring compatibility with a variety of systems. It operates at a supply voltage for logic (VCC) ranging from 3.1V to 3.5V, with a typical value of 3.3V, and supports a 16:9 aspect ratio for optimized display content.

The module is designed to withstand operating temperatures from -20℃ to +70℃, and storage temperatures from -30℃ to +80℃, offering reliable performance in a wide range of industrial environments.

O-Film Technology Advantage

Currently, TFT displays with wide viewing angle functionality include MVA (Multi-domain Vertical Alignment), IPS (In-Plane Switching), and O-Film technologies. Compared to MVA and IPS, O-Film TFT offers a more cost-effective solution for achieving wide viewing angles, making it one of the best choices for industrial applications.

Most industrial TFT-LCD modules use TN-LCD panels, which suffer from significant grayscale inversion at wide angles. In these panels, lower grayscales can appear brighter than higher ones, affecting image clarity. The O-Film TFT module used in the WF43VSZAEDNT0 addresses this issue by enhancing the viewing angle and improving grayscale consistency, making it ideal for industrial applications where display clarity and visibility are paramount.

SPECIFICATIONS

General Specifications

Item Dimension Unit
Size 4.3 inch
Dot Matrix 480 × RGB × 272(TFT) dots
Module dimension 105.5(W) × 67.2(H) × 4.05(D) mm
Active area 95.04 × 53.856 mm
Dot pitch 0.066 × 0.198 mm
LCD type TFT, Normally White, Transmissive
View Direction 12 o'clock
Gray Scale Inversion Direction 6 o'clock
Aspect Ratio 16:9
Driver IC ST7282-G4-1L
Interface 24-bit RGB
Backlight Type LED, Normally White
Touch Screen Resistive touch screen (RTP)
Surface Anti-Glare

Absolute Maximum Ratings

Item Symbol Min Typ Max Unit
Operating Temperature TOP -20 +70
Storage Temperature TST -30 +80

Electrical Characteristics

Item Symbol Min Typ Max Unit
Power Supply For Logic VCC 3.1 3.3 3.5 V
Power Supply For Current ICC - 22 33 mA

Interface

Pin Symbol Function
1 VLED- Power for LED backlight cathode
2 VLED+ Power for LED backlight anode
3 GND Power ground
4 VDD Power voltage
5 R0 Red data (LSB)
6~11 R1~R6 Red data
12 R7 Red data (MSB)
13 G0 Green data (LSB)
14~19 G1~G6 Green data
20 G7 Green data (MSB)
21 B0 Blue data (LSB)
22~27 B1~B6 Blue data
28 B7 Blue data (MSB)
29 GND Power ground
30 CLK Pixel clock
31 DISP Display on/off
32 HSYNC Horizontal sync signal; negative polarity
33 VSYNC Vertical sync signal; negative polarity
34 DE Data Enable
35 NC No connection
36 GND Power ground
37 XR Right electrode
38 YD Down electrode
39 XL Left electrode
40 YU Top electrode
